LG Display LM238WF4-SSA1: High-Performance 23.8-Inch IPS Panel for Industrial Displays

The LG Display LM238WF4-SSA1 offers display system developers a highly integrated, space-saving Full HD solution designed to simplify HMI mechanical integration. Specs: 23.8-inch | 1920x1080 (FHD) | 1000:1 Contrast Ratio. Key benefits include wide 178-degree viewing angles and a matte 3H anti-glare finish. Engineers seeking a drop-in replacement or design panel for industrial HMIs will find its standard 30-pin LVDS interface and 5.0V supply highly compatible. Key Parameter Overview

Decoding the Specs for Enhanced Display System Integration

The technical specifications of the LM238WF4-SSA1 reflect its design focus on optical clarity and electrical simplicity. Below is the highlighted key indicators table:

Technical Parameter Specification Value Design Importance / Value
Screen Diagonal 23.8 inches (60.47 cm) Optimal screen real estate for desktop monitors and human-machine interfaces.
Active Area 527.04 x 296.46 mm Provides a standard 16:9 widescreen layout.
Resolution 1920 x 1080 (FHD) Ensures sharp image rendering at 92 PPI.
Luminance 250 cd/m² (Typ.) Suitable for indoor office and controlled control room environments.
Contrast Ratio 1000:1 (Typ.) Maintains sharp text legibility and deep black levels.
Interface Type LVDS (2 ch, 8-bit) 30 pins Ensures high-speed data transfer with excellent noise immunity.
Logic Input Voltage VLCD 5.0V (Typ.) Standard rail voltage compatible with common single-board computers.
Surface Finish Matte (Haze 25%), 3H Hard Coating Minimizes reflections and resists scratches.
Backlight Type WLED (Without Driver) Requires external constant current driver for flexibility.

Technical Deep Dive

Understanding the IPS Liquid Crystal Alignment and LVDS Signaling Protocol

The core technology behind the LM238WF4-SSA1 lies in its transmissive IPS (In-Plane Switching) structure. Standard display designs are often limited by color distortion when viewed from steep angles. In this panel, the liquid crystal molecules are aligned parallel to the glass substrates.

To visualize how this works, think of the liquid crystal molecules as horizontal Venetian blinds. Instead of tilting up and down when voltage is applied, they rotate flatly within the same plane. This rotation ensures light passes uniformly at all angles, which completely prevents the grayscale inversion common in older TN panels. For data transmission, the panel utilizes a 2-channel 8-bit LVDS interface. What is the primary interface of the LM238WF4-SSA1? A dual-channel 8-bit LVDS interface.

To minimize signal degradation, think of the dual-channel LVDS interface as a two-lane highway where data is sent as differential voltage pairs. This configuration effectively cancels out common-mode noise. This enables clean signaling over longer cabling inside industrial PC enclosures without requiring heavy shielding. This interface design easily complies with electromagnetic compatibility standards in automation environments. Integrating a separate LED backlight driver is straightforward due to the WLED backlight arrangement. The backlight requires a 4-string constant current source. Isolating the driver board from the panel allows engineers to customize thermal dissipation, extending the backlight lifespan and reducing the cost compared to fully integrated industrial-grade display modules.

Frequently Asked Questions

Practical Integration Answers for Display Engineers

What is the typical current consumption of the logic board for the LM238WF4-SSA1?

The logic board operates on a 5.0V supply and typically draws 570mA under a standard mosaic pattern test. The maximum current draw is rated at 713mA, and designers must account for a maximum inrush current of 3A lasting up to 5 milliseconds during startup.

How does the IPS transmissive mode improve visual clarity in control rooms?

The transmissive IPS mode guarantees symmetric 178-degree viewing angles horizontally and vertically. This guarantees that operators sitting off-center can view data charts without experiencing color shifts or contrast degradation, boosting safety in control rooms.

Does this display panel include an integrated LED driver for the backlight?

No, the LM238WF4-SSA1 does not include an integrated LED driver. It requires an external constant-current backlight driver capable of delivering the appropriate current to its White LED string configuration.
